Ram ProMaster City Wagon Model Years and History

About ProMaster City

Two years after the Ram truck brand received its first influence from Fiat's commercial vehicle portfolio with the ProMaster van, a smaller cargo hauler. Suited for urban use and small-scale businesses, the Ram ProMaster City premiere for the 2015 model year included a cargo van and passenger-oriented wagon version. Configured for a maximum five-passenger capacity, the ProMaster City Wagon came with a 54.7-inch long cargo floor behind the second-row seating. A cargo space length expands to 69.2 inches when the 60/40 split Fold & Tumble rear seats are folded down allowing the Ram ProMaster City Wagon to haul a maximum 101.7 cubic feet worth of items. Available in a base trim as well as SLT trim model, the ProMaster City Wagon's propulsion comes exclusively from a 2.4-liter TigerShark four-cylinder engine mated to a nine-speed automatic transmission. Adding confidence as a passenger van, the Ram ProMaster City Wagon included seven airbags and air conditioning. SLT models incorporated an Uconnect 5.0 system operating through a touch-screen display. Only minor changes were made to the ProMaster City Wagon between the 2016 and 2017 model year.
